AuthInfoRequired-Cups überschreibt

AuthInfoRequired-Cups überschreibt

Mein Problem ist im Wesentlichen identisch mit dem folgenden:

http://bbs.archlinux.org/viewtopic.php?id=61826

Einfach ausgedrückt: Ich habe eine Maschine in Ubuntu, die versucht, über ein Netzwerk eine Verbindung zu einer anderen Ubuntu-Maschine herzustellen, um den angeschlossenen Drucker zu verwenden. Es gibt kein Problem beim Drucken, bis ich die Gastmaschine neu starte. Sofort überschreibt sie die Datei printers.conf (unter /etc/cups/printers.conf).
Sie fügt immer dieselbe Zeile hinzu:

AuthInfoErforderlicher Benutzername, Passwort

Ich stoppe CUPS und ändere es in **#**AuthInfoRequired username,password, um den Befehl auszukommentieren. Starte CUPS. Funktioniert bis zum nächsten Herunterfahren einwandfrei. Dann wird es wieder überschrieben.

Beim Googeln scheint es sich möglicherweise um ein GTK-Problem und nicht um ein CUPS-Problem zu handeln, aber ich habe bisher keine dauerhafte Lösung gefunden.

Alle Vorschläge sind willkommen …

Antwort1

Sie können es auch anders machen.

Geben Sie am Ende von AuthInfoRequired einfach „none“ ein. Es wird ungefähr Folgendes erwartet:

AuthInfoRequired none

Antwort2

Ich habe Benutzer und Passwort zur SMB-Freigabe beispielsweise so hinzugefügt:

smb://joe:not24get@winstation/printer

und es wurde aufgehört, diese Zeile hinzuzufügenprinters.conf

Wenn Ihre Windows-Station keine Anmeldung erfordert, geben Sie einfach Dummy-Daten ein:

smb://Benutzer:@winstation/Drucker

verwandte Informationen